Understanding Respite Care in Mansfield

Respite Care in Mansfield provides essential support to caregivers, offering them a chance to rest and recharge while their loved ones continue to receive care. Understanding the types of respite care available and how they can benefit both the caregiver and the person receiving care is important. Services range from in-home care to short stays in specialised facilities, depending on the individual’s needs.

Choosing the Right Respite Care Provider

When selecting a respite care provider, consider factors like the quality of care, the training and experience of the staff, and the flexibility of the services offered. It’s essential to choose a provider that aligns with the specific needs of the individual and can offer a seamless continuation of care.

The Benefits of Respite Care

Respite care offers numerous benefits, not just for the primary caregiver but also for the person receiving care. It provides a change of environment and routine, which can be refreshing and stimulating. For caregivers, it offers an opportunity to rest, attend to personal matters, or simply take a break, which is essential for maintaining their own well-being.

Tailoring Respite Care to Individual Needs

When it comes to respite care, a one-size-fits-all approach does not work. Tailoring the care to meet individual needs is crucial for the well-being of both the person receiving care and the caregiver.

  • Assessment of Needs: Before beginning respite care, a thorough assessment should be conducted to understand the specific needs and preferences of the individual.
  • Flexible Scheduling: Flexibility in scheduling respite care is essential to accommodate the unique circumstances of each caregiver and their loved ones.
  • Specialised Care for Various Conditions: Respite care providers should be equipped to handle specific health conditions, whether they be physical, mental, or developmental.

Building Trust and Comfort

For respite care to be effective, building trust and comfort between the care recipient, their family, and the respite care provider is essential.

  • Consistent Caregivers: Whenever possible, providing consistent caregivers can help in building a sense of familiarity and trust.
  • Open Communication: Maintaining open and regular communication with the family ensures that they are informed and comfortable with the care being provided.
  • Feedback Mechanisms: Implementing a system for feedback allows families to share their experiences and suggestions, which can be used to improve the service.
